COURT HEARING - VGASTRO BAR FOURTH TRIAL ********************************************************************* The fourth trial of VGastro Bar case proceeds at Bahan court in Yangon on Friday. Two local defendants, bar owner Htun Thurein and manager Htut Ko Ko, who’ve been charged under the sub-section A of section 295, were tried and cross-examined in this trial. The 40-year-old nightspot’s owner, Htun Thurein, said he’s not responsible for that, claiming this happened over the internet, not in his nightspot. He also said he only came to know about the picture with Buddha wearing the headphones when a friend of his rang him. He then phoned the general manager New Zealander to remove it right away. Htut Ko Ko Lwin, manager of the bar, also said that he came to know about the picture and crime only when police force came to the bar. The mother of the local manager of the bar claimed that her son is not responsible for the crime because he’s join the spotlight for a week ago. The plaintiff, Than Htike – township administrator of Bahan Township –was also tried and cross-examined in this trial. The witnesses will be summoned in the next trial, which is on 12th January.
